Communication across a geographically disperse workforce is a challenge, however, as a business, we are doing our best to create a united team, whether you work in a branch in Auckland New Zealand, Kalgoorlie WA or our Brisbane Support Office, we want all employees to feel connected and part of our team.

Our geographical spread, creates a communication challenge, one which we are committed to positively addressing.

Some of the ways we communicate across our business include:

Monthly “In-Touch” Newsletter

Our internal employee communication newsletter “In-Touch” implemented over two years ago has a mix of information, recognition, key messages as well as competitions, In-Touch has been well received and will continue to be an important part of our internal communication plan.

Branch Managers Council (BMC)

Our Branch Manager Council, provides an essential two-way communication opportunity between our Support Office and our Branch Network, through regional branch representation. Our business success is critically linked to these two key elements of our business being aligned and working closely together. We call our “head office”, our “Support Office” for a reason and we need to ensure we are providing the appropriate level of support to our branch network.

The success in 2010 was outstanding and we have chosen to continue our Branch Manager Council in 2011 and we foresee this continuing into the future. Our Branch Manager Council meets bi-monthly and includes our Leadership Team and peer elected Branch Managers representing each of our Regions.

Employee Intranet

Our internal Intranet is an important communication medium for our business. It houses a wide range of information from news items, policy and procedure information, product videos, etc.

Innovation Pipeline

We have an innovation Pipeline portal on our Intranet called “Spark” where we encourage employees to share with us their suggestions for improvement opportunities.  This is just one further way of capturing feedback from our employees.
